Svelte 5 is not Javascript
Svelte 5 is not Javascript.
Svelte 5 as a case study in how abstractions aimed at simplifying concepts can actually make software development more complex.

The key takeaway from the article:
Don’t choose tools that alienate you from your work. Choose tools that leverage the wisdom you’ve already accumulated, and which help you to cultivate a deeper understanding of the discipline.
And I think this explains the current frustrations with most frameworks: they are always hiding something. Something important.
Sometimes it seems a framework is the punishment you get for not knowing the fundamentals. And if you do know the fundamentals, then the framework is the punishment you get for being too smart
